Canada Pension Plan Investment Board grew its position in PACCAR Inc (NASDAQ:PCAR – Free Report) by 34.5% in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m owned 342,717 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 87,900 shares during the period. Canada Pension Plan Investment Board owned about 0.07% of PACCAR worth $28,668,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

PACCAR Stock Performance
NASDAQ:PCAR opened at $90.67 on Wednes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.49, a quick ratio of 2.38 and a current ratio of 2.61. The stock has a market capitalization of $47.43 billion, a P/E ratio of 11.58, a PEG ratio of 0.98 and a beta of 0.89.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$85.06 and a 200 day moving average price of $81.80. PACCAR Inc has a fifty-two week low of $64.33 and a fifty-two week high of $91.09.
PACCAR (NASDAQ:PCAR –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, October 24th. The company reported $2.34 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.07 by $0.27. The firm had revenue of $8.70 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$8.19 billion. PACCAR had a net margin of 12.01% and a return on equity of 31.31%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 23.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.47 EPS. Equities research analysts forecast that PACCAR Inc will post 8.99 EPS for the current year.
PACCAR Dividend Announcement
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, November 15th. Investors of record on Wednesday, December 6th will be given a dividend of $0.27 per share. This represents a $1.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.19%. PACCAR’s payout ratio is currently 13.79%.
PACCAR Profile
PACCAR Inc designs, manufactures, and distributes light, medium, and heavy-duty commercial trucks in the United States, Europe, Mexico, South America, Australia,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Truck, Parts, and Financial Services. The Truck segment designs, manufactures, and distributes trucks for the over-the-road and off-highway hauling of commercial and consumer goods.
